Is Pet Daycare Safe?
While some dogs do not prosper in day care atmospheres (especially those with full days of disorganized free play) most can take advantage of the social interaction and exercise. Regular workout assists canines burn off power and can lower behavioural problems like barking, excavating, eating.
When selecting a childcare, look at the facility itself: Is it huge sufficient? Does it have areas for quiet/low energy play and locations for pet dogs to pull out of interactions?
Safety First
There are a few worries to be knowledgeable about when considering dog daycare. One of the most crucial is that some pets can be overstimulated in this setting. This can lead to a high-octane mayhem that is not conducive to good behavior. Therefore it is necessary to find a facility that focuses on training and can acknowledge behavioral hints of when a pet dog is also worried or fired up.
An additional concern is the risk of illness and injury. Respectable centers have rigorous wellness and inoculation plans in position to make certain the safety and security of all dogs. However, there is a risk that your dog may pick up kennel cough or other diseases from other canines.
Some canine day cares likewise have cams in the backyard that you can enjoy from your home. This can be an excellent method to watch on your puppy however it can trigger anxiety for the pet dog since they can be regularly distracted by other people viewing them.
Supervision
Dogs are dyadic by nature and thrive ideal in individually managed play sessions with suitable play companions chosen by a behaviorist. Nevertheless, since canine daycare facilities are often run by people that enjoy pets yet do not have substantial backgrounds in ethology and cognitive ethology as well as positive support training, teams of pet dogs are normally overstimulated or enter fights that can turn unsafe. After that there are occurrences like the one in which a 15-week old Dachshund was eliminated at a day care facility.
Professional caretakers recognize canine body movement and can step in rapidly before a problem rises. They likewise understand how to read a pet's state of mind, and when they see indications of worry, anxiety, frustration or overstimulation (looking at one more dog with climbing hackles, cowed stooping, tucked tail) it is time to separate them from the team. They make use of space dividers, playthings and kennels to maintain playgroups little and manageable while giving the pets with a chance to decompress or recoup from workout.
Tidiness
The cleanliness of your pet dog's day care facility is vitally important. Try to find facilities that sanitize all surface areas frequently, including bed linens, playthings and dog recipes. Be careful of facilities that rely upon bleach water-- it will certainly break down and destroy surface areas unless it's rinsed off immediately. Detergent-based items are much more reliable and much safer to use.
Watch out for any type of daycare that has an online reputation for stinky kennels or rooms. This is an indicator that they are not complying with correct cleansing procedures.
Various other signs of a secure and clean center include hygienic bed linen and sleeping locations for each pet dog, floor drains pipes in each kennel and the availability of fresh alcohol consumption water. The facility needs to likewise have plenty of area for the dogs to play and rest, as overcrowding can bring about aggressive actions. They ought to additionally carry out a behavior evaluation on each pet to ensure they can securely communicate with the various other canines in their treatment.
Training
Many childcares operate as a little a totally free for all. It's high octane chaos that isn't constantly healthy and balanced for the canines entailed. For some canines this isn't a trouble but for several dogs this type of unstructured atmosphere can amount to tension and overstimulation that will certainly result in behavior issues when the pet returns home.
Even if the daycare you select has excellent cleanliness techniques and vaccination plans there is still a risk of illness spread via mingling in between canines. Additionally, canines might be injured throughout play. It's not uncommon for a canine to be kicked by an additional canine or to obtain a scratch during among the many supervised play sessions.
For most pet dogs that are well interacted socially, learnt basic obedience commands and do not have actions problems like splitting up anxiety day care can be a wonderful method for them to work out and play with other pet pals while their human beings are away. But, prior to sending your dog to day care ask on your own if it is the best selection for them and do your research.
